Medical Errors
While most of us would like to believe that we can trust our doctors, nurses, and pharmacists to keep us safe and help us to be as healthy as possible, the unfortunate truth is that medical errors occur every day. In fact, medical errors are a leading cause of death in the United States, with approximately 100,000 people dying each year as a result of medication errors, surgical errors, incorrect diagnoses, and other medical errors. Some studies suggest the numbers are even higher. Even those who survive sometimes must deal with serious illnesses or life-altering injuries. Looking at the types of medical errors that have occurred over the years is a frightening prospect. Some patients have had the incorrect surgery performed on them, resulting in loss of an organ—or even a limb. Some have suffered because surgical tools were left inside them or because the surgeon was not careful and damaged sensitive organs or tissue near the area of operation. Some people have been killed or nearly killed when given the incorrect medication or the incorrect dose of a medication. Sometimes the incorrect prescription is given by the doctor, who failed to take into account the medical allergies listed on the patient’s chart. Sometimes patients are treated for the wrong illness due to incorrect diagnosis. The list of medical errors goes on and on.
